Tech News : Global Call-Spoofing Operation Shut Down

The UK’s National Crime Agency (NCA) has shut down a global call-spoofing operation called ‘Russian Coms’ which is believed to have been used to swindle more than 170,000 victims. Sustainability-in-Tech : Is New Membrane Carbon-Capture Game-Changer?

Newcastle University researchers have reported developing a new ambient-energy-driven membrane that can pump carbon dioxide out of the air. Featured Article : Children Hide Online Life From Families

New research by the Children’s Commissioner for Wales, Rocio Cifuentes, has revealed that only 1 in 4 children in Wales tell their families about their online life.
